Color is spot on perfect. There has been quite a bit of discussion about coveralls. Pocket flap is square and even with pocket. That’s fact, There’s a few brands out there like that, but have snap collars; I and a few others have square flap olive bigmacs with herringbone pattern, but there again, sleeves are buttons and what we see on film are snaps. one thing people debate is the herringbone pattern, several stating they see no pattern on film, therefor saying a smooth cotton/poly. Eh this one is not 100% to me, in low light, grainy pictures, etc the herringbone would be hard to spot, whether it’s there or not. It may not have a pattern, but eh. until we find out the EXACT brand AND style, what you have is perfect. A great pickup indeed!!
